Heartened and grateful
Most of the time when I read the periodicals, the words of the articles go into my heart as a metaphysical treatment. I feel the settled truth of them and consider this magnified in the thought of everyone reading the articles. Today, when I felt how wonderfully the two articles “A guest of God” and “Home, unconfined” (Virginia Anders and Heidi K. Van Patten, Sentinel, March 12, 2018) bring out the idea of our dwelling as ideas in Mind, I thought that the people putting these periodicals together know this is true, and the people writing the articles know, and since Truth itself is the only thing with any power, then this must become known in the world. I feel heartened and very grateful.

Inspired me to pray
[Sentinel Watch, Joel Magnes, Marie Longpré-Adams, and Mark Catlin, “Freedom from contagion,” JSH-Online.com, March 5, 2018]
This well-done podcast has really inspired me to pray for myself as well as for others. Christian Science always helps me to claim health from God. God is always good, and He cannot cause sickness. I always remember that good is contagious, not sickness. In the Bible, it is well written that “ye shall know the truth, and the truth shall make you free” (John 8:32).
